Prepare Now For Heat Stress On The Way - Dr. Stu Rympf
As the weather starts to warm up, dairy producers face the looming challenge of heat stress in their dairy herds. With temperatures rising earlier than usual, the need to manage the heat becomes increasingly urgent. Heat stress poses a considerable risk to the health, well-being and production of dairy cows. As we approach the summer months, it’s critical to have prevention and control strategies in place to mitigate its impact.
Dr. Stuart Rymph, technical support dairy nutritionist for Purina Animal Nutrition, joins Pam Jahnke to share prevention and control strategies to help producers prepare for the warm weather ahead.
